Kate Beckinsale to star in new thriller The Widow

Kate Beckinsale is to star in the new Amazon TV thriller ‘The Widow’.
The 44-year-old actress has been added to the cast of the eight-episode drama, which is to be written and produced by ‘The Missing’ and ‘Fleabag’ brothers Harry and Jack Williams.
In a joint statement announcing Kate’s casting, the Williams brothers said: "Kate Beckinsale is a brilliantly talented actress and we’re thrilled she’s joining us on this journey – we couldn’t imagine anyone more perfect for the role.
"’The Widow’ is our most ambitious and cinematic piece to date and we can’t wait to bring the dark heart of the Congolese jungle to the screen."
Kate is poised to play the part of Georgia Wells, who has distanced herself from her previous life and is a completely different woman to who she once was.
Georgia is forced to face the harshness of her reality when she sees has late husband on the news.
As the story progresses, Georgia goes into the depths of the African Congo, where she encounters danger every step of the way.
The show will premiere on ITV in the UK and on Amazon Prime Video in the US, with production poised to begin later this month in South Africa, Wales and the Netherlands.
Kate has a long-standing working relationship with Amazon, having previously starred in ‘The Only Living Boy in New York’ and the comedy ‘Love & Friendship’.
However, the upcoming series will mark the brunette beauty’s first scripted series regular role, after spending the bulk of her career to date working in the movie business.
